前端使用插件导出表格数据到Excel
1、安装 vue-json-excel 依赖
npm install vue-json-excel
2、初始化 vue-json-excel
import Vue from 'vue'
import JsonExcel from 'vue-json-excel'Vue.component('downloadExcel', JsonExcel)
3、准备数据
在这里我们需要准备两个数据:
表头数据: headerData
表格数据: tabelData
(变量名可根据自己喜好定义)
4、html代码
<download-excel :data="tabelData" :fields="headerData"type="xlsx"worksheet="My Worksheet":name="title"><el-button type="primary">导表</el-button>
</download-excel>
data:要导出的表格数据,
fields: 表头数据,
type:导出文件的格式,
worksheet:导出xlsx文件内的名称,
name: 导出表格的名称,
5、js代码
this.title = '导出表格数据'
this.headerData = {'姓名': 'name','年龄': 'age','性别': 'sex',
}
// key代表需要导出的每一列数据的名称,value代表对应的参数,和表格的prop没有关联,可以自己定义this.tabelData = [{'name': 'tom','age': '7','sex': '男',},{'name': 'jerry','age': '5','sex': '男',}
]
// 这里的key要和表头中定义的value要一样,不然导出的数据就没有
这里需要注意的是 ‘headerData ’ 的value值和 ‘tabelData ’ 数据的key要相同,这也是最重要的一点;
好了,导出表格数据就完成了,看看数据吧
6、导出数据查看
前端使用插件导出表格数据到Excel相关推荐
- js+PHP利用PHPExcel导出表格数据到excel
这里写自定义目录标题 前言 通过js筛选出表格数据 PHP利用PHPExcel导出表格数据到excel 前言 因为在开发平台的时候遇到了需要将表格数据导出到Excel的情况,通过百度找到了PHP插件P ...
- 标题vue导出表格数据,excel表格打不开
vue导出表格数据,excel表格打不开 代码如下,当时是将**responseType: 'blob'**写在{headers: getHeader() }外面,导致问题一直没解决,后来经过度娘,了 ...
- ant-design pro导出表格数据为Excel文件
环境React+Ant Design 一.安装插件js-export-excel 1.yarn安装-记得以管理员身份执行 yarn add js-export-excelnpm安装 npm insta ...
- ant-design pro导出表格数据为Excel文件
环境React+Ant Design 一.安装插件js-export-excel 1.yarn安装-记得以管理员身份执行 yarn add js-export-excelnpm安装 npm insta ...
- fastadmin中使用phpExcel导出表格数据到excel中
虽然说fastadmin中表格自带导出excel,但是那个东西忒不好用了,每次点击导出,就刷新表格,默认最近七天的数据,所以无奈之下只好另寻办法了,废话不多说,接下来说一下phpExcel的使用: 一 ...
- oracle 数据 导出 excel 自动分多个文件,从oracle数据库中导出大量数据到excel中为什么自动分成了好几个excel文件《excel表格新手入门》...
EXCEL中一个单元格中多行文本如何导入或复制到SQL SERVER 数据库表中? 保留换行符保存进数据表啊,读取出来显示的时候根据需要进行转换就行了,比如要在网页上显示,可以把换行符转换成HTML的 ...
- vb用数组方式快速导出MSFlexGrid表格数据到Excel表格中
本来从MSFlexGrid或MSHFlexGrid导出数据到Excel中,是一个非常简单的问题,但论坛里还是经常有人问如何导出,有的虽然知道用单元格赋值方式循环导出,但速度太慢,因此写了一个通用的数据 ...
- vue中导出json数据为excel表格并保存到本地
继我上次成功利用vue和elemen把excel的数据导入至前端vue,因为excel表中的数据有些必填项没有填写或者填写错误(比如写错字)所以就要将没有成功导入的数据导出成一份excel表并保存至本 ...
- php输出json到表格,Vue如何导出json数据到Excel电子表格方法
本文主要介绍了Vue导出json数据到Excel电子表格的示例,小编觉得挺不错的,现在分享给大家,也给大家做个参考,希望能帮助到大家. 一.安装依赖(前面基本一样) npm install file- ...
最新文章
- 2019寒假作业二:PTA7-1币值转换
- 详解网页中的关键词分布技术
- Nginx七层负载均衡配置
- 苹果cms V8 蓝色手机模板
- request-爬取一张图片的练习-答案-私
- UVA5876 Writings on the Wall 扩展KMP
- http请求中get和post方法的区别
- Python:一文让你彻底理解numpy中axis=-1/0/1/2... [实例讲解:np.argmax(axis= -1 0 1 2) np.sum(aixs= -1 0 1 2)]
- 2019南昌网络赛H The Nth Item(二阶线性数列递推 + 广义斐波那契循环节 + 分段打表)题解...
- 将十进制IP转换成二进制IP
- 模拟城市5一直显示服务器中断,EA关闭《模拟城市5》非关键功能缓解服务器问题...
- 解决雷神笔记本风扇声音太响太吵问题
- Github开始强制使用PAT(Personal Access Token)了
- 经典游戏----飞机大战
- 记唐晓芙---围城第一遍略读后记
- html图片十字形,CSS3 十字架
- APP测试基本流程及测试基本点
- Windows Server 2008之旅??Windows Server Backup功能_闲云野鹤?精神家园_百度空间
- kvm切换器不了linux系统,KVM切换器使用中最常见故障排除处理
- 软考高项:信息系统项目管理师笔记-信息化和信息系统 (P2)